BALTIMORE, MARYLAND – The Baltimore Police Department is investigating a shooting that took place on May 14th. This incident happened on 2900 Block of Edmondson Avenue in Southwest Baltimore.

According to detectives, “At approximately 3:10 a.m., Southwest District patrol officers received a call for a shooting that occurred in the 2900 block of Edmondson Avenue. Once there, officers located a 37-year-old male with a graze wound to the hand. The victim was transported to an area hospital for treatment. Southwest District detectives are investigating this incident. “
